Manitoba's manufacturing sector has experienced significant growth, establishing itself as a cornerstone of the province's economy. Traditionally centered around resource processing industries such as meatpacking, flour milling, and lumber production, the sector has diversified into technology-driven fields, including aeronautical systems and electrical equipment manufacturing.

In 2022, Canada's manufacturing sector reached new heights, with total revenue increasing by 17.4% to $922.4 billion. This growth was driven by heightened demand and notable price increases across various subsectors.

Manitoba's manufacturing landscape is supported by organizations like Canadian Manufacturers & Exporters (CME) Manitoba, which offers resources in areas such as productivity, technology, trade, and workforce development to bolster the sector's growth.
